Niels W. Gade is one of the main figures in Danish Romaticism. His Elverskud is one of the best-known Danish works with dramatic action based on old Danish ballads. Along with Frülings-Phantasie, which was one of the most popular works in Gade's lifetime, Elverskud represents Danish Romatic Music at its finest.
